+
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_scale_color_d
+//       Access: Public
+//  Description: Converts an integer (typically a uint8) value to a
+//               floating-point value.  If the contents value
+//               indicates this is a color value, scales it into the
+//               range 0..1 per convention; otherwise leaves it alone.
+////////////////////////////////////////////////////////////////////
+INLINE double GeomVertexColumn::Packer::
+maybe_scale_color_d(unsigned int value) {
+  if (_column->get_contents() == C_color) {
+    return (double)value / 255.0;
+  } else {
+    return (double)value;
+  }
+}
+    
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_scale_color_d
+//       Access: Public
+//  Description: Converts a pair of integers into the _v2d member.  See
+//               one-parameter maybe_scale_color_d() for more info.
+////////////////////////////////////////////////////////////////////
+INLINE void GeomVertexColumn::Packer::
+maybe_scale_color_d(unsigned int a, unsigned int b) {
+  if (_column->get_contents() == C_color) {
+    _v2d.set((double)a / 255.0,
+             (double)b / 255.0);
+  } else {    
+    _v2d.set((double)a, (double)b);
+  }
+}
+    
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_scale_color_d
+//       Access: Public
+//  Description: Converts a pair of integers into the _v3d member.  See
+//               one-parameter maybe_scale_color_d() for more info.
+////////////////////////////////////////////////////////////////////
+INLINE void GeomVertexColumn::Packer::
+maybe_scale_color_d(unsigned int a, unsigned int b, unsigned int c) {
+  if (_column->get_contents() == C_color) {
+    _v3d.set((double)a / 255.0,
+             (double)b / 255.0,
+             (double)c / 255.0);
+  } else {    
+    _v3d.set((double)a, (double)b, (double)c);
+  }
+}
+    
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_scale_color_d
+//       Access: Public
+//  Description: Converts a pair of integers into the _v4d member.  See
+//               one-parameter maybe_scale_color_d() for more info.
+////////////////////////////////////////////////////////////////////
+INLINE void GeomVertexColumn::Packer::
+maybe_scale_color_d(unsigned int a, unsigned int b, unsigned int c,
+                    unsigned int d) {
+  if (_column->get_contents() == C_color) {
+    _v4d.set((double)a / 255.0,
+             (double)b / 255.0,
+             (double)c / 255.0,
+             (double)d / 255.0);
+  } else {
+    _v4d.set((double)a, (double)b, (double)c, (double)d);
+  }
+}
+    
+
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_unscale_color_d
+//       Access: Public
+//  Description: Converts a floating-point value to a uint8 value.  If
+//               the contents value indicates this is a color value,
+//               scales it into the range 0..255 per convention;
+//               otherwise leaves it alone.
+////////////////////////////////////////////////////////////////////
+INLINE unsigned int GeomVertexColumn::Packer::
+maybe_unscale_color_d(double data) {
+  if (_column->get_contents() == C_color) {
+    return (unsigned int)(data * 255.0);
+  } else {
+    return (unsigned int)data;
+  }
+}
+    
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_unscale_color_d
+//       Access: Public
+//  Description: Converts an LVecBase2d into a pair of uint8
+//               values.  See one-parameter maybe_unscale_color_d() for
+//               more info.
+////////////////////////////////////////////////////////////////////
+INLINE void GeomVertexColumn::Packer::
+maybe_unscale_color_d(const LVecBase2d &data) {
+  if (_column->get_contents() == C_color) {
+    _a = (unsigned int)(data[0] * 255.0);
+    _b = (unsigned int)(data[1] * 255.0);
+  } else {
+    _a = (unsigned int)data[0];
+    _b = (unsigned int)data[1];
+  }
+}
+    
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_unscale_color_d
+//       Access: Public
+//  Description: Converts an LVecBase3d into a pair of uint8
+//               values.  See one-parameter maybe_unscale_color_d() for
+//               more info.
+////////////////////////////////////////////////////////////////////
+INLINE void GeomVertexColumn::Packer::
+maybe_unscale_color_d(const LVecBase3d &data) {
+  if (_column->get_contents() == C_color) {
+    _a = (unsigned int)(data[0] * 255.0);
+    _b = (unsigned int)(data[1] * 255.0);
+    _c = (unsigned int)(data[2] * 255.0);
+  } else {
+    _a = (unsigned int)data[0];
+    _b = (unsigned int)data[1];
+    _c = (unsigned int)data[2];
+  }
+}
+    
+////////////////////////////////////////////////////////////////////
+//     Function: GeomVertexColumn::Packer::maybe_unscale_color_d
+//       Access: Public
+//  Description: Converts an LVecBase4d into a pair of uint8
+//               values.  See one-parameter maybe_unscale_color_d() for
+//               more info.
+////////////////////////////////////////////////////////////////////
+INLINE void GeomVertexColumn::Packer::
+maybe_unscale_color_d(const LVecBase4d &data) {
+  if (_column->get_contents() == C_color) {
+    _a = (unsigned int)(data[0] * 255.0);
+    _b = (unsigned int)(data[1] * 255.0);
+    _c = (unsigned int)(data[2] * 255.0);
+    _d = (unsigned int)(data[3] * 255.0);
+  } else {
+    _a = (unsigned int)data[0];
+    _b = (unsigned int)data[1];
+    _c = (unsigned int)data[2];
+    _d = (unsigned int)data[3];
+  }
+}
